class CustomLoggingIntegration(CustomLogger):
def __init__(self) -> None:
super().__init__()
def logging_hook(
self, kwargs: dict, result: Any, call_type: str
) -> Tuple[dict, Any]:
input: Optional[Any] = kwargs.get("input", None)
messages: Optional[List] = kwargs.get("messages", None)
if call_type == "completion":
# assume input is of type messages
if input is not None and isinstance(input, list):
input[0]["content"] = "Hey, my name is [NAME]."
if messages is not None and isinstance(messages, List):
messages[0]["content"] = "Hey, my name is [NAME]."
kwargs["input"] = input
kwargs["messages"] = messages
return kwargs, result
def test_guardrail_masking_logging_only():
"""
Assert response is unmasked.
Assert logged response is masked.
"""
callback = CustomLoggingIntegration()
with patch.object(callback, "log_success_event", new=MagicMock()) as mock_call:
litellm.callbacks = [callback]
messages = [{"role": "user", "content": "Hey, my name is Peter."}]
response = completion(
model="gpt-3.5-turbo", messages=messages, mock_response="Hi Peter!"
)
assert response.choices[0].message.content == "Hi Peter!" # type: ignore
time.sleep(3)
mock_call.assert_called_once()
print(mock_call.call_args.kwargs["kwargs"]["messages"][0]["content"])
assert (
mock_call.call_args.kwargs["kwargs"]["messages"][0]["content"]
== "Hey, my name is [NAME]."
)
def test_guardrail_list_of_event_hooks():
from litellm.integrations.custom_guardrail import CustomGuardrail
from litellm.types.guardrails import GuardrailEventHooks
cg = CustomGuardrail(
guardrail_name="custom-guard", event_hook=["pre_call", "post_call"]
)
data = {"model": "gpt-3.5-turbo", "metadata": {"guardrails": ["custom-guard"]}}
assert cg.should_run_guardrail(data=data, event_type=GuardrailEventHooks.pre_call)
assert cg.should_run_guardrail(data=data, event_type=GuardrailEventHooks.post_call)
assert not cg.should_run_guardrail(
data=data, event_type=GuardrailEventHooks.during_call
)
